Western blot - Anti-Serpin A5 antibody [EPR23337-69] (AB270450)
Blocking and diluting buffer and concentration : 5% NFDM/TBST.
The expression profile/molecular weight observed is consistent with what has been described in the literature. The band detected around 100 kDa could be either the dimeric form or serpin A5 in complex with a serine protease such as urokinase or kallikrein. Bands around 50 kDa represent the intact and cleaved forms (PMID : 22206708).

Biological function summary
Serpin A5 regulates critical physiological processes through its inhibitory function. It interacts with and inhibits target proteases controlling pathways involved in coagulation and fibrinolysis. Serpin A5 does not form part of larger protein complexes but exerts its function through direct interactions. Its modulatory action impacts processes such as cell migration and tumor invasion highlighting its role in broader cellular environments.
Pathways
Serpin A5 is an important regulator in the coagulation cascade and fibrinolytic pathways. It acts to modulate the balance between coagulation and fibrinolysis critical for maintaining hemostasis. This protein is related to other serpins such as Antithrombin III and Plasminogen activator inhibitor-1 through its regulatory actions in these pathways. The inhibition of proteases by Serpin A5 ensures proper activation and termination of these biological processes which are essential for vascular integrity.
